1. Automate Your Processes

One of the biggest time-wasters in any retail operation is manual processes. Whether it’s manually inputting data into spreadsheets, updating inventory levels by hand, or sending out emails individually, these tasks can quickly eat into your team’s productivity. That’s why automation is such a valuable tool. By using software to automate these routine tasks, you free up your team to focus on higher-value activities. From marketing automation to inventory management systems, there are many different types of automation tools available that can help you streamline your operations and boost your productivity.

2. Optimize Your Space

Another way to increase productivity in your retail business is to optimize your physical space. This can be done in a number of ways. For example, you could reorganize your store layout to improve customer flow and reduce bottlenecks. You could also use technology to streamline your checkout process and reduce wait times. Additionally, you could invest in better lighting and signage to make your products more visible and easier to find. By making these small changes, you can create a more efficient and productive environment for your employees and customers alike.

3. Leverage Data Analytics

Data analytics has become an essential tool for many businesses, and the retail industry is no exception. By collecting and analyzing data on everything from sales trends to customer behavior, you can gain valuable insights that can help you make smarter, more informed decisions. For example, you might use data analytics to identify your best-performing products and focus your marketing efforts on promoting them. Or you might use data to pinpoint areas of your operations that are underperforming and make targeted improvements. Whatever your goals, data analytics can give you the information you need to achieve them.

4. Implement Lean Principles

Finally, if you want to maximize efficiency in your retail business, it’s important to implement lean principles. At its core, lean is about eliminating waste in all its forms. This might mean reducing excess inventory, cutting unnecessary steps in a process, or minimizing downtime on equipment. By adopting a lean mindset, you can create a culture of continuous improvement that drives productivity and innovation. And with the right training and support, your employees can become lean experts themselves, identifying inefficiencies and suggesting improvements at every turn.
